What can you tell me about First Hope Bank in general?

First Hope Bank is a community bank, which opened its doors for business on March 4, 1912. It is a privately held institution that has been operated by the Beatty family since its founding. The Bank's mission is to provide financial solutions that help customers achieve their hopes and dreams while enhancing the growth and prosperity of First Hope Bank and our community. When are checks available?

Deposits are available on the next business day. However, our business day ends at 3:00 p.m. EST Monday through Friday for transactions performed at the teller line and with your Debit MasterCard®. So, a check deposited after 3:00 p.m. EST on a Friday will not be available until the following Tuesday, since it was officially deposited on Monday.

What time does your business day end?

Our business day ends at 3:00 p.m. EST Monday through Friday for transactions performed at the teller line and with your Debit MasterCard®. However, for transactions performed through Hope Online, the business day ends at 6:00 PM EST. Therefore, you can make transfers or perform bill payments through Hope Online until 6:00 PM EST to have them processed on today's business day.

What do you offer business customers?

For business customers, First Hope offers FREE business checking with no per check charges and next day availability. Additionally, we offer a commercial cash sweep with the ability to sweep excess funds overnight into a money market account. If you are looking for commercial loans, we offer time and term loans both on a secured or unsecured basis. Additional services include a business debit card, credit card services, ACH Direct Deposit and wire transfers.

How can I download my account information into my financial software?

You can download account information from your current and your previous statement into QuickBooks, Quicken, or Microsoft Money by following these steps:

  1. Log in to your Hope Online access.
  2. Select the account in question from your Accounts list.
  3. Pull down the "Transactions" menu and click "Transactions Export".
  4. Enter the pertinent information in the fields provided, select the type of file to which you wish to export, and click the "Export" button.
